Output 52f571ce3966b16623ef1e0308600405979f7b9412685a077c92f4744ee452c3:8

value
884300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 619556c56c3f28238547a0d3d5adffa94c609921 OP_EQUALVERIFY OP_CHECKSIG
address
DE34z7og62hQa9bXypLftUHHdp9a4myeGV
transaction
52f571ce3966b16623ef1e0308600405979f7b9412685a077c92f4744ee452c3